Inspection history
9 inspections on record, most recent Feb 25, 2026. 4 of 9 visits and reports cited a standard.
Feb 25, 2026Inspection3 standards cited
- 747.5337(a)(3)Texas HHSC risk level: Medium High
Electric or Battery Operated CO System-Document Test Date, Battery Installation Date and Staff Name conducting Testing and Installation
At the time of the inspection there were no documentation of the carbon monoxide detector, fire extinguisher or smoke detector for January 2026. NOTE: Compliance has been met when inspections were conducted.
Corrected Feb 25, 2026, at the inspection · Technical assistance given
- 747.613(b)Texas HHSC risk level: Medium
Required Immunizations Records, Exceptions, and Exemptions Current
One of the three children immunization record wasn't update with current immunizations.
Corrected Mar 25, 2026 · Technical assistance given
- 747.4303(b)Texas HHSC risk level: Medium
Cots, Beds, Mats Labeled With Child's Name
At the time of inspection, the cots were observed not labeled with the child's names. NOTE: Compliance has been met as the cots were labeled.
Corrected Feb 25, 2026, at the inspection · Technical assistance given

Nov 30, 2023Inspection5 standards cited
- 747.401(a)(2)Texas HHSC risk level: Medium
Posting Requirements-Inspection Report
The operation does not have the most recent inspection form posted.
Corrected Dec 15, 2023 · Technical assistance given
- 745.621(b)(1)(A)Texas HHSC risk level: High
AP Renewal background checks submitted -No later than 5 yrs from date last submitted subjects initial or renewal fingerprint-based criminal hist check
The provider's backgorund check is more than 5 year old. The last submitted date was 8/29/2018
Corrected Dec 1, 2023 · Technical assistance given
- 747.2315(b)Texas HHSC risk level: High
AP Cribs - Only Snug Fitting Sheet and Crib Mattress Cover Allowed if Infant Younger than 12 Months of Age
An infant was seen sleeping a crib with a stuffed toy also in the crib.
Corrected Nov 30, 2023 · Technical assistance given
- 747.5005(1)Texas HHSC risk level: Medium High
Fire Drill Monthly - Exit in 3 Minutes
The operation os not conducting monthly fire drills. The last drill was conducted in September 2023.
Corrected Dec 15, 2023 · Technical assistance given
- 747.2326(a)(1)Texas HHSC risk level: High
Infant May Not Sleep in a Restrictive Device
An Infant was found asleep in a bouncer.
Corrected Nov 30, 2023 · Technical assistance given

May 23, 2023Inspection4 standards cited
- 747.5005(2)Texas HHSC risk level: Medium High
Sheltering drill for Severe Weather- 4 times in a calendar year
A severe weather drill has not been conducted, as required.
Corrected Jun 9, 2023
- 747.5005(3)Texas HHSC risk level: Medium High
Lock-down drill 4 times in a calendar year
A lock down drill has not been conducted, as required.
Corrected Jun 9, 2023 · Technical assistance given
- 747.3501Texas HHSC risk level: Medium High
Safety - Areas Free From Hazards
The wooden exit fence was removed from the backyard, creating a hazard. The grass in the backyard was observed over grown.
Corrected Jun 9, 2023 · Technical assistance given
- 747.5107(b)Texas HHSC risk level: Medium High
Fire Extinguishers Serviced
The fire extinguisher has not been serviced. The fire extinguisher was last serviced June 2021.
Corrected Jun 9, 2023 · Technical assistance given
